Tyler Campbell serves as the Head Coach of Liberty University Rock Climbing, where he combines his passion for the outdoors with a deep commitment to student development. He began climbing in 2010 during his sophomore year at Liberty and quickly fell in love with the sport. Since joining the coaching staff in 2016—first as an Assistant Coach and now as Head Coach—he has played a key role in the team’s growth, overseeing training, competition logistics, and athlete development.
Tyler’s coaching philosophy is rooted in both technical excellence and personal growth. He is passionate about helping athletes reach new heights not only in their climbing abilities but also in their character and faith. His goal is to create an environment where student-athletes are challenged, encouraged, and equipped to glorify God through their sport.
In addition to coaching, Tyler serves as an Academic Mentoring Specialist for Club Sports at Liberty University. In this role, he provides tailored academic support and personal mentoring, helping student-athletes navigate both their educational and life goals. He also brings nearly a decade of leadership experience from his time as a Contact Center Supervisor in Liberty’s Student Accounts Office, where he led a team of 15 and focused on professional development and service excellence.
Tyler holds a Bachelor of Science in Biblical Studies from Liberty University and is dedicated to fostering excellence in both academic and athletic arenas.
